June 15, 2022(1 event) What is a Continuing Tutorship and Does My Child Need One?What is a Continuing Tutorship and Does My Child Need One? – What is a Continuing Tutorship and Does My Child Need One? - Is your child age fifteen and not yet age eighteen? When a Child reaches the age of eighteen, he/she is of the age of majority and presumed to be competent under the law. He/she is permitted by law to make healthcare, education, and finance decisions. Learn the legal consequences, legal effects, and procedures to obtain a Continuing Tutorship for your child.
